(2025.12.17聖靈的安慰)
凡稱呼我為主的人,要在這邪惡污穢的世界中作清潔的人;惟有分別為聖,才能躲避這彎曲悖逆世代一切的惡;凡事都可以行,但不都有益處,不可容許污穢沾染到自己的身上;那些無益、對靈命有虧損、並會帶來毀壞的事,要逃避、要遠離;那些悖逆之人所行出的不義惡言惡行,你要厭惡;要主動遠離與拒絕罪惡,否則惡便趁機臨到,影響人的心思,進而行背離真理之事;這是關乎靈魂得救的事,不可輕忽;
世界的惡者每天餵養人恐懼、仇恨、嫉妒、貪婪的慾望、虛假、驕傲、自義、絕望,為要使人失去對神信靠的心,奪去人的心,使人轉而抓住世界短暫的安全感,阻擋人悔改回轉向神,引人走向死亡,在不知不覺中,任意毀壞自己的生命;
在一切事上務要謹慎,免得使自己落入試探;凡事警醒,不被世界同化;不成為絆倒別人的人,自己也不被絆倒;
萬民哪,要追求善道,就是追求公義、敬虔、信心、愛心、忍耐與溫柔;以神的公義為行事準則,不任意而為,不偏行己路;當將神放在首位,順服神的誡命與吩咐,不再為自己而活;在遭遇逼迫、處於試煉之中時,信心不動搖,仍堅定地倚靠神;行事為人由愛而發出,愛神愛人,為神的家而勞苦,使屬神國的人天天增加;在不義中仍不以惡報惡,用忍耐、溫柔的心去面對並勸勉人,使人認識自己的錯誤而向神悔改,使自己不沾染污穢,也能挽回人的靈魂;
要追求信仰的品德,內心要被神的光照耀,內在的生命要被更新;凡是真實的、可敬的、公義的、清潔的、可愛的、有美名的,都要仔細思索;要脫離虛假,因撒但也裝作光明的天使,你們不要效法惡,不活在虛假的光中,不用謊言包裝外在,也不自己欺騙自己,要有真實的敬虔與誠實的心;要守住屬神國子民尊貴的身分,使神得着榮耀;要成為正直、公義、無可指責的人;從內裡至外在都要保守聖潔,動機純正,思想不被世界的潮流污染;要有良善、溫柔的心,不製造分裂、仇恨與紛爭;活出基督的生命,見證神的恩典,榮耀神的名;
真正盼望神國的人是有福的;凡恆心行善、行公義道路、分別為聖的人,能脫離兇惡,免於惡者的試探;今生或許為守真理而受苦,只要持守忍耐到底,持守所信的道,必有榮耀的冠冕為你存留;按着神的公義,在所定的時候,必將你應得的分賜給你。
聖經
(創世記4:7)
你若行得好,豈不蒙悅納?你若行得不好,罪就伏在門前。它必戀慕你,你卻要制伏它。」
(雅各書2:17,20-22)
這樣,信心若沒有行為就是死的。…虛浮的人哪,你願意知道沒有行為的信心是死的嗎?我們的祖宗亞伯拉罕把他兒子以撒獻在壇上,豈不是因行為稱義嗎? 可見,信心是與他的行為並行,而且信心因着行為才得成全。
(羅馬書2:6-11 )
他必照各人的行為報應各人。凡恆心行善、尋求榮耀、尊貴和不能朽壞之福的,就以永生報應他們; 惟有結黨、不順從真理、反順從不義的,就以忿怒、惱恨報應他們; 將患難、困苦加給一切作惡的人,先是猶太人,後是希臘人, 卻將榮耀、尊貴、平安加給一切行善的人,先是猶太人,後是希臘人。 因為神不偏待人。
(腓立比書4:8)
弟兄們,我還有未盡的話:凡是真實的、可敬的、公義的、清潔的、可愛的、有美名的,若有甚麼德行,若有甚麼稱讚,這些事你們都要思念。

Holding to Holiness and Living Out the Life That Comes from God in a Crooked and Rebellious Generation
(The Encouragement of the Holy Spirit, 2025.12.17)
All who call Me Lord must live as clean and holy people in this evil and defiled world. Only by being set apart can you escape the evil of this crooked and rebellious generation. Though many things may be permitted, not all are beneficial. Do not allow anything unclean to stain your life. Flee from and stay away from things that bring no spiritual benefit, that harm your spiritual life, or that lead to destruction. Detest the unrighteous words and deeds of those who live in rebellion. Actively reject and distance yourself from sin, or else evil will seize the opportunity to influence your thoughts and lead you away from the truth. This concerns the salvation of your soul and must not be taken lightly.
The evil one feeds people daily with fear, hatred, jealousy, greed, falsehood, pride, self-righteousness, and despair, seeking to strip away their trust in God. He captures their hearts, draws them toward the world’s temporary sense of security, blocks repentance, and leads them toward death, causing them to destroy their own lives without even realizing it. Be careful in all things, so that you do not fall into temptation. Stay alert, and do not be shaped by the world. Do not become a stumbling block to others, and do not allow yourself to be stumbled.
People of all nations, pursue the good way—pursue righteousness, godliness, faith, love, endurance, and gentleness. Let God’s righteousness be the standard for your actions. Do not live however you please, and do not follow your own path. Put God first, submit to His commands and instructions, and no longer live for yourself. When persecution comes and you are tested, let your faith remain unshaken as you continue to rely firmly on God. Let all you do be motivated by love—love God and love others. Labor for God’s household so that those who belong to His kingdom may increase day by day. Even when surrounded by injustice, do not repay evil with evil. Face people with patience and gentleness, exhorting them so they may recognize their wrongdoing and repent before God. In this way, you keep yourself unstained and also help rescue souls.
Pursue the virtues of faith. Let your heart be illuminated by God’s light, and let your inner life be renewed. Whatever is true, honorable, righteous, pure, lovely, and worthy of praise—think carefully on these things. Break free from falsehood, for Satan disguises himself as an angel of light. Do not imitate evil, and do not live in a false light. Do not dress up appearances with lies, and do not deceive yourself. Live with genuine godliness and an honest heart. Guard the noble identity of those who belong to God’s kingdom so that God may be glorified. Become upright, righteous, and blameless people. From the inside out, keep yourselves holy, with pure motives and minds not polluted by the world’s trends. Have hearts that are kind and gentle, not creating division, hatred, or conflict. Live out the life of Christ, bear witness to God’s grace, and glorify His name.
Blessed are those who truly hope in God’s kingdom. Those who persevere in doing good, walk the path of righteousness, and live set apart will be delivered from evil and protected from the schemes of the wicked one. In this life, you may suffer for holding fast to the truth, but if you endure to the end and remain faithful to what you believe, a glorious crown is being kept for you. According to God’s righteousness, at the appointed time, He will give you the portion that is rightfully yours.
Scripture
Genesis
Chapter 4 Verse 7
“If thou doest well, shalt thou not be accepted?
and if thou doest not well, sin lieth at the door.
And unto thee shall be his desire, and thou shalt rule over him.”
James
Chapter 2 Verses 17, 20–22
“Even so faith, if it hath not works, is dead, being alone.
But wilt thou know, O vain man, that faith without works is dead?
Was not Abraham our father justified by works,
when he had offered Isaac his son upon the altar?
Seest thou how faith wrought with his works,
and by works was faith made perfect?”
Romans
Chapter 2 Verses 6–11
“Who will render to every man according to his deeds:
To them who by patient continuance in well doing
seek for glory and honour and immortality, eternal life:
But unto them that are contentious, and do not obey the truth,
but obey unrighteousness, indignation and wrath,
Tribulation and anguish, upon every soul of man that doeth evil,
of the Jew first, and also of the Gentile;
But glory, honour, and peace, to every man that worketh good,
to the Jew first, and also to the Gentile:
For there is no respect of persons with God.”
Philippians
Chapter 4 Verse 8
“Finally, brethren, whatsoever things are true,
whatsoever things are honest,
whatsoever things are just,
whatsoever things are pure,
whatsoever things are lovely,
whatsoever things are of good report;
if there be any virtue, and if there be any praise,
think on these things.”
